摘要: 这个学期参加了不少的笔试和面试,有必要对笔面试中常考的知识点进行针对性的总结,特别是容易遗漏的、容易被问懵逼的问题,对我连C++虚函数都不知道的菜鸟来说,及时查漏补缺,完善自我知识体系,是提升自我、提升面试能力的重要手段。 把这些容易忽略的知识点总结出来,有助于日后复习巩固,也希望对还没找到互联网实 阅读全文
posted @ 2017-06-29 02:08 constructora 阅读(107) 评论(0) 推荐(0) 编辑
摘要: 函数原型如下: 阅读全文
posted @ 2017-06-28 22:57 constructora 阅读(877) 评论(0) 推荐(0) 编辑
摘要: 1.如果是整型变量或字段,使用intval()函数把所有的参数转换成一个数值,比如翻页,按ID浏览文章 2.对于字符型变量,用addslashes()将所有的单引号、双引号、反斜杠和空字符转换为含有反斜线的溢出字符,或使用 mysqli_real_escape_string 函数进行转义 3.转义一 阅读全文
posted @ 2017-04-06 14:55 constructora 阅读(116) 评论(0) 推荐(0) 编辑
摘要: 非递归思路需要总结归纳,分奇数偶数讨论,略。 阅读全文
posted @ 2017-04-06 11:20 constructora 阅读(796) 评论(0) 推荐(0) 编辑
摘要: 和意料之中差不多,因为自己搞的PHP方向,前几个学期专业课没好好学,期末都是低分飘过...牛客刷的也不多,所以做得很一般。 总结一下: 1.选择题30题:数据结构5道左右,数据库3道左右,C++10道左右,操作系统5道左右,算法设计3道左右,概率题3道左右,磁盘存储2道。都是基础题型,感觉范围和考研 阅读全文
posted @ 2017-04-04 01:02 constructora 阅读(678) 评论(0) 推荐(0) 编辑
摘要: 考虑这样一个题目,将一个十进制数转换城二进制,然后统计二进制数中1的个数,有哪些解法? 第一反应想到的解法是在原来数的基础上作 >> 移位运算,缺点在哪里呢? 没有考虑负数的情况,负数右移时,为了保证移位后的数还是负数,高位还是会补0,因此会陷入死循环 更好的解法: 1.不在原来的数上操作,而是左移 阅读全文
posted @ 2017-03-30 12:15 constructora 阅读(124) 评论(0) 推荐(0) 编辑
摘要: PHP: 1.双引号里可以存放变量,输出前会经过翻译处理;单引号就是一存粹的字符串,不会被翻译。 2.单引号能简单地处理 '\' '\\' 两个转义字符来转义和" ' \ " 冲突的字符,而双引号能处理所有转义字符。即: echo 'what\'s my name?'; //用斜杠转义 当你想在字串 阅读全文
posted @ 2017-03-13 16:51 constructora 阅读(263) 评论(0) 推荐(0) 编辑
摘要: class10 多态多态简单说就是用不同的类去实现同一个接口的方法,以实现不同类自己的方法eat("FOOD"); // 不需要知道到底是Human还是Animal,直接吃就行了 }else{ echo "Can't eat!\n"; }}$man = new Human();$monke... 阅读全文
posted @ 2015-12-05 11:57 constructora 阅读(189) 评论(0) 推荐(0) 编辑
摘要: class07overwrite(重写)和Final关键字overwrite(重写):在子类中编写一个与父类function完全一样的function,实现子类特定的功能final关键字:final翻译过来就是"最终"的意思。final定义的函数或类,不能被子类重写,如果重写将会报错moreTest... 阅读全文
posted @ 2015-12-05 09:37 constructora 阅读(176) 评论(0) 推荐(0) 编辑
摘要: class04 类的继承name . "'s eating ". $food. "\n"; }}// extends关键字用于说明该类继承自某个父类class NbaPlayer extends Human{ // 类的属性的定义 public $team="Bull"; p... 阅读全文
posted @ 2015-12-05 09:14 constructora 阅读(165) 评论(0) 推荐(0) 编辑